Requirements
  • Around 5 years of experience in H&S Compliance Audits, H&S Due Diligences and related consultancy services.
  • Degree in Engineering, Geology or Environmental Sciences.
  • An excellent level of English (B2/C1).
  • Knowledge of current Italian legislation framework regarding H&S requirements.
  • Development, implementation, and auditing of Quality (ISO 9001), Environment (ISO 14001) and Safety (ISO 45001) Management Systems.
  • Excellent abilities of analysis and synthesis.
  • Excellent relationship skills and teamwork attitude.
  • Availability to travel in Italy and abroad.
Responsibilities
  • H&S Compliance audits aimed at assessing H&S compliance against local legislation, internal clients and European standards.
  • Identification of potential H&S costs and definition of corrective actions to meet legislative requirements and associated costs, also in the frame of pre-acquisition, merge and divestiture projects of commercial and industrial sites.
  • Development and implementation of H&S integrated management systems.
  • Development and implementation of legal tracking systems, H&S training.
  • H&S Due Diligences.
Desired Qualifications
  • Knowledge of the Environmental legislation for Due Diligence and Compliance Audits.
  • Knowledge and Risk Assessment of Organizational Management systems according to Lgs.D. 231/2001.

Arcadis provides design, engineering, and consultancy services focused on natural and built assets. The company operates globally, serving clients in various sectors across The Americas, Europe, the Middle East, and the Asia Pacific. Its services are organized into four main areas: Places, which focuses on sustainable buildings and urban management; Mobility, which enhances transportation infrastructure; Resilience, which helps clients address climate change and environmental challenges; and Intelligence, which offers data-driven insights to improve asset performance. Unlike many competitors, Arcadis emphasizes integrated solutions that tackle complex client challenges, generating revenue through fees for its services. The company's goal is to create sustainable environments and improve quality of life through its comprehensive approach.
